At MAPS 2026, Novellia CEO and Co-Founder Shashi Shankar will be co-presenting a 90-minute interactive workshop that explores how tethered education—a model that aligns clinician and patient learning—can drive stronger engagement, better communication, and ultimately, better outcomes.
Beyond the Stethoscope: The Intersection of Patient and Clinician Education
March 22–25, 2026
Denver, CO | MAPS 2026 Annual Meeting
Healthcare has never been more complex—or more fragmented. Patients and clinicians alike are navigating evolving therapies, shifting guidelines, and growing volumes of data. But what often gets overlooked is the disconnect in how each side learns.
That’s where tethered education comes in.
This workshop will unpack real-world strategies for delivering synchronized, stakeholder-aware education—linking what clinicians know and what patients understand, in order to close knowledge gaps and strengthen shared decision-making across the care continuum.
Participants will engage in interactive peer discussions, walk through real-world scenarios, and leave with practical, immediately applicable strategies.
